Lucy Marie
Krichbaum
Aug 6, 1916 — Nov 28, 2016
Lucy Marie Krichbaum of rural Loudonville went home to be with the Lord on
November 28, 2016. The daughter of Warren C. and Anna (Huff) Anderson was born
on August 6, 1916 in Lake Township on the Anderson Homestead. She finished her
education at Emerick School.
Lucy worked at the Ashland County Children's Home for 4 years, as a
cook/housekeeper. She was a member of the Mohicanville Community Church
all her life.
William A. (Bill) Krichbaum became her husband on June 1, 1940. After Bill's death in
1973, she went to work for Scenic Orchard, picking apples and helping to make cider.
She worked hard all her life and enjoyed it. Lucy also babysat for many grandchildren
and great grandchildren. She enjoyed gardening, reading, embroidery and baking
cookies.
